Lisianthus and Red Currant Bloom time

Lisianthus and Red Currant bloom time is the season in which the flowers of these plants bloom. Knowing the bloom time of plants will help you plan your garden properly. Along with Lisianthus and Red Currant Care, Lisianthus and Red Currant season is a very important to know. You can know the bloom time of these plants and its other features before planting it in your garden. Lisianthus bloom time is Spring, Late Spring, Early Summer, Summer and Late Summer whereas Red Currant bloom time is Early Spring and Spring.

Lisianthus and Red Currant Type of Soil

Knowing the type of soil is a very important part of gardening. The good quality of the soil improves Lisianthus and Red Currant Benefits. The growth of plant is dependent on the type of soil used. Every plant requires different types of soil, some may need a loamy type of soil while some need soil which has a good drainage capacity. Knowing the pH of the soil will ensure the proper growth of the plant and it will also enhance your gardening skills. Lisianthus and Red Currant type of soil is as bellow:

  • Lisianthus type of soil: Clay, Loam, Sand
  • Red Currant type of soil: Loam

The pH of soil can be of three types: Alkaline, Acidic and Neutral. Lisianthus and Red Currant pH of soil is as follows:

  • Lisianthus pH of soil: Neutral, Alkaline
  • Red Currant pH of soil: Acidic, Neutral
